As part of Orac’s Digital Marketing team, you will manage our corporate website oracdecor.com, which plays a central role in our digital marketing strategy, reaching customers across multiple European markets.
You’ll own the technical health, content accuracy and user experience of our site ensuring it delivers seamless experiences that drive engagement and support business goals.
Key responsibilities:
* Manage & optimize the international oracdecor.com website: Build, update and maintain website pages, troubleshoot issues. Implement SEO and UX improvements, and monitor site performance.
* Manage & update website content and product data: Ensure accurate, brand-consistent, and timely publication of error-free content.
* Support digital campaigns: Translate marketing initiatives into engaging web experiences with accurate content and product data. Coordinate translations.
* Support collaboration with marketing, digital, and local teams to align on priorities, deadlines, and content needs.
* Analyze & improve: Use analytics tools to detect issues, optimize workflows and boost conversion rates.
* Structure and manage workflows via Jira, track tickets, report status, flag blockers, and maintain an organized backlog.
This is how we describe you
* Bachelor’s degree in Digital Media, Computer Science, Digital Design & development, Application development, Communications or a related field.
* Hands-on experience managing websites using modern CMS platforms.
* Strong digital affinity with excellent attention to detail.
* Demonstrated ownership of projects and ability to meet deadlines.
* Analytical and problem-solving mindset.
* Excellent communication skills and collaborative spirit.
Nice to have
* Experience with Adobe Commerce or other CMS
* Familiarity with Jira, DevOps or other similar tool
* Understanding of UX/UI principles and best practices
* Familiarity with Akeneo PIM or similar product platforms
* Basic HTML/CSS knowledge and ability to make minor code adjustments
* Knowledge of web hosting and domain management.
* Experience with SEO, Google Analytics, Tag Manager, and conversation rate optimization (CRO)
